Dell Technologies (NYSE:DELL) Trading Down 1.9% – Here’s What Happened

Dell Technologies Inc. (NYSE:DELLGet Free Report) shares traded down 1.9% during trading on Thursday . The stock traded as low as $93.60 and last traded at $94.40. 1,605,867 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 84% from the average session volume of 10,019,139 shares. The stock had previously closed at $96.26.

Dell Technologies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 2nd. Investors of record on Tuesday, April 22nd will be issued a $0.525 dividend. This is an increase from Dell Technologies’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.45. This represents a $2.10 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.27%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, April 22nd. Dell Technologies’s payout ratio is presently 33.76%.

Dell Technologies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Dell Technologies Inc designs, develops, manufactures, markets, sells, and supports various comprehensive and integrated solutions, products, and services in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Asia, and internationally. The company operates through two segments, Infrastructure Solutions Group (ISG) and Client Solutions Group (CSG).
